Sen. Lugar addresses Brookings Institute

May 1, 2006

Sen. Richard Lugar, R-Ind., recently spoke before the Brookings Institute, a Washington, D.C.-based think tank, about America's energy security and the importance of promoting renewable fuels. Specifically, Lugar said it was time that consumers had access to E85; if the major oil companies didn't want to install the pumps, Congress may have to step in.
"If these [oil] companies do not take advantage of the incentives Congress has provided, I would be in favor of legislation mandating that they install E85 pumps in appropriate markets," Lugar said. "It is time for the oil companies to make E85 available to the consumer."
Lugar added that he would be working with Sen. Barack Obama, D-Ill., to introduce legislation that would provide auto makers incentives to produce flexible fuel vehicles and establish a director of energy security.
